WIRE — The federal government has approved a take-off establishment of 1,200 personnel for the Federal University of Technology Akure Teaching Hospital (FUTATH), marking a major milestone in the transition of the institution into a full-fledged federal teaching hospital. The chief medical director of the hospital, Prof. Olusegun Ojo, disclosed this on Monday during a press briefing
